The type of scooter you select will also affect the cost. For instance, portable lightweight scooters are usually less expensive than traditional models. They are able to be disassembled to fit in a vehicle or trunk. They have a lower capacity for weight and operate with a shorter range of operation compared to regular models.

A mobility scooter class 3, on the other hand is able to be used on public roads and is able to carry more cargo. This kind of scooter is more expensive than the class 2 model however it can be worth the extra cost for some users.

Mobility scooters are different from wheelchairs due to their ability to navigate on uneven terrains and can be driven along sidewalks. They are also usually lighter than power wheelchairs and are generally regarded as having lesser stigmas for disabilities by able-bodied people. These advantages make them more appealing to certain users, but they do have some disadvantages. They might not be able to access certain lifts or vehicles made for wheelchair users and their length may make it difficult to reach doorknobs and door opener buttons.

Consider buy a mobility scooter of the scooter prior to purchasing it. If you are buying an old model, look for documents that show how often the scooter was serviced. Check that the tires are in good condition. If the tires are worn this means that the scooter was idle for a while.

You should also examine the battery condition, which is usually listed in the manual. If it's low it may be time to replace it. Beware of a used scooter that is advertised as brand new. These models are usually sold at a cheaper price than the original retail cost and often do not come with warranties.

Before purchasing a scooter, take into consideration where and how you will make use of it. If you plan to go to the mall often then a small, light scooter could be ideal for you. If you'll be using parks and sidewalks or on trails, a larger heavy-duty model could be more suitable.

It's also important to determine whether your insurance policy will cover your scooter. Medicare for instance, covers scooters, mobility aids and other durable medical equipment (DME) under Part B. Consult your physician about the condition you suffer from and determine if eligible.
